Within the Aged and Disability department AccessCare, the Community Support team assists people to remain living in their own homes and stay connected to their community with transport to essential services and social activities.

The role

We are seeking a Community Bus driver (casual) to join the Social Engagement team based at Dingley Village. Reporting to the Community Access Coordinator, your role is to:

  • To transport bus passengers in a safe, enjoyable, and courteous manner meeting all compliance requirements, including any regulations due to COVID-19 protocols. 
  • To observe the health and wellbeing of passengers and report any concerns in a confidential, non-judgemental manner.
  • Plan and monitor rosters and transport routes to support all scheduled bus activity.
  • Engage with a range of stakeholders external to AccessCare, to support passengers in a range of activities.

About you

You will have:

  • Heavy Duty Licence and Driver’s Certificate/knowledge of requirements for these licences
  • Driver’s accreditation
  • Car licence
  • Working with Children’s Check
